Crystal structure of the H101A mutant ecHint GMP complex

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 20934431

About this Structure

3N1T is a 4 chains structure with sequences from Escherichia coli.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.

Reference

  • Bardaweel S, Pace J, Chou TF, Cody V, Wagner CR. Probing the Impact of the echinT C-Terminal Domain on Structure and Catalysis. J Mol Biol. 2010 Oct 8. PMID:20934431 doi:10.1016/j.jmb.2010.09.066
